+# creature script that simulates a conversation with a creature
+
+# configuration:
+
+## name attached to the creature's messages
+NAME = 'summer'
+## name attached to the user's messages
+MYNAME = 'you'
+## "corpus file" containing examples to learn from
+CORPUS = 'summer.corpus.txt'
+
+# end of configuration
+
+
+import random
+import re
+
+filters = list()
+bigrams = dict()
+trigrams = dict()
+
+with open(CORPUS, 'r') as f:
+ corpus = '\n' + f.read() + '\nUSERTEXT'
+
+tokens = ['\nUSERTEXT', ' CREATURETEXT', ' ENDCONVO']
+
+def tokenise(tokens, text):
+ result = list()
+ for word in re.split('(?=[^A-Za-z:0-9<>])', text):
+ if word not in tokens:
+ tokens.append(word)
+ result.append(tokens.index(word))
+ return result
+
+def detokenise(tokens, stuff):
+ return ''.join([tokens[t] for t in stuff])
+
+def add_filters(filters, material, window):
+ start = 0
+ while start + window < len(material):
+ filt = set()
+ after = set()
+ for t in material[start:start+window]:
+ if t > 2: filt.add(t)
+ for t in material[start+window:start+int(window*1.5)]:
+ after.add(t)
+ if len(filt) > 0: filters.append((filt, after))
+ start += window // 2
+
+def add_ngrams(ngrams, material, window):
+ for i in range(len(material) - window):
+ key = tuple(material[i:i+window])
+ if key not in ngrams:
+ ngrams[key] = dict()
+ gram = material[i+window]
+ if gram not in ngrams[key]:
+ ngrams[key][gram] = 0
+ ngrams[key][gram] += 1
+
+def add_new_to_corpus(question):
+ print(f" * {NAME} didn't know what to say. Please suggest something appropriate:")
+ newanswer = input('> ')
+ newstuff = tokenise(tokens, newanswer)
+ with open(CORPUS, 'a') as f:
+ f.write(f'USERTEXT {question} CREATURETEXT {newanswer}\n')
+ return newstuff
+
+
+def infer(filters, bigrams, trigrams, context):
+ scores = dict()
+ nkey = tuple(context[-2:])
+ if nkey in trigrams:
+ for a, m in trigrams[nkey].items():
+ if a not in scores:
+ scores[a] = 0.001
+ #scores[a] += m * 0.2 * (n+1)
+ permit_bullshit = len(scores) <= 0
+ bigram = bigrams[(context[-1],)]
+ for f, a in filters:
+ m = 0
+ for t in context[-len(f):]:
+ if t in f:
+ m += 0.1 if t <= 2 else 1
+ for n in a:
+ if n in scores:
+ scores[n] += m / len(f)
+ elif permit_bullshit:
+ scores[n] = m / len(f) + (bigram[n] if n in bigram else 0)
+ choices = random.choices(list(scores.items()), list(scores.values()), k=1)
+ choice = max(choices, key=lambda c: c[1])[0]
+ maxv = max([c[1] for c in choices])
+ #print(f'confidence: {maxv}')
+ if maxv < 1: return -1
+ return choice
+
+material = tokenise(tokens, corpus)
+add_filters(filters, material, 2)
+add_filters(filters, material, 4)
+add_filters(filters, material, 8)
+add_filters(filters, material, 16)
+add_filters(filters, material, 32)
+
+add_ngrams(bigrams, material, 1)
+add_ngrams(trigrams, material, 2)
+
+newstuff = []
+
+shouldask = True
+while True:
+ if shouldask:
+ try:
+ question = input(f'<{MYNAME}> ')
+ except EOFError:
+ exit()
+ newstuff += tokenise(tokens, '\nUSERTEXT ' + question + ' CREATURETEXT')
+ promptlength = len(newstuff)
+ done = False
+ shouldquit = False
+ maxn = 5000
+ while not done and maxn > 0:
+ nexttoken = infer(filters, bigrams, trigrams, newstuff)
+ if (nexttoken == -1):
+ answertokens = add_new_to_corpus(question)
+ newstuff += tokenise(tokens, ' ') + answertokens + [0]
+ nexttoken = 0
+ done = True
+ question = detokenise(tokens, answertokens)
+ continue
+ done = nexttoken <= 2
+ shouldquit = nexttoken == 2
+ shouldask = nexttoken == 0
+ newstuff.append(nexttoken)
+ maxn -= 1
+
+ answer = detokenise(tokens, newstuff[promptlength:-1])[1:].strip()
+ if len(answer) > 0:
+ print(f'<{NAME}> ', end='')
+ print(answer)
+
+
+ if shouldquit: break
